Design and Portability

The Nebula Capsule Max features a compact cylindrical design, weighing only 1.6 pounds. Its built-in handle makes it incredibly portable, allowing you to carry it with ease.

The XGIMI Mogo Pro, on the other hand, has a more traditional boxy design with a retractable handle. It’s slightly heavier at 2.2 pounds but still portable enough for outdoor adventures.

Display Quality

Both projectors offer sharp and vibrant images. The Nebula Capsule Max boasts a native resolution of 720p and a brightness of 200 ANSI lumens, delivering a clear and detailed picture even in dimly lit environments.

The XGIMI Mogo Pro takes it a step further with a native resolution of 1080p and a brightness of 300 ANSI lumens. Its higher resolution ensures razor-sharp images, while the increased brightness makes it suitable for use in brighter settings.

Battery Life

The Nebula Capsule Max has a built-in battery that lasts for up to 4 hours of continuous playback. It can be charged via USB-C or a power bank, making it ideal for extended outdoor use.

The XGIMI Mogo Pro has a slightly longer battery life of up to 5 hours. However, it requires a proprietary charger, which may limit its portability.

Price

The Nebula Capsule Max is priced at around $499, while the XGIMI Mogo Pro retails for $599. The price difference reflects the higher resolution and brighter display of the XGIMI projector.
